What is Mobile Commerce (M-Commerce)?
E-commerce conducted in a wireless environment using mobile devices and the Internet.
What are three key drivers of M-Commerce development?
- Widespread mobile device adoption. 2. Declining prices. 3. Improved bandwidth.
What are two major benefits of M-Commerce for businesses?
Expanded market reach and increased customer satisfaction.
What are two major benefits of M-Commerce for consumers?
Convenience and personalized experiences.
What are the three main types of wireless transmission media?
Microwave, Satellite, and Radio.
What are the advantages of microwave transmission?
High bandwidth and cost efficiency.
What are the disadvantages of microwave transmission?
Requires line of sight and is susceptible to environmental interference.
What are the three types of satellites used in wireless transmission?
Geostationary Earth Orbit (GEO), Medium Earth Orbit (MEO), and Low Earth Orbit (LEO).
What is the primary use of MEO satellites?
Supporting Global Positioning Systems (GPS).
What are the advantages of radio transmission?
High bandwidth, passes through walls, inexpensive, and easy to install.
What is GPS and how does it work?
A satellite-based system that determines precise locations using signals from MEO satellites.
What are the three categories of wireless computer networks?
Short-range, medium-range, and wide-area wireless networks.
What is Bluetooth?
A short-range network creating personal area networks (PANs) for up to 100 meters.
What is Near-Field Communication (NFC) used for?
Enabling contactless payments (e.g., mobile wallets).
What is Wi-Fi?
A medium-range wireless LAN replacing cables for internet access.
What is WiMAX and its main advantage?
A wide-area wireless network with a 50 km range, ideal for rural broadband access.
What is mobile computing?
Real-time connections between devices and other computing environments.
What are the two main characteristics of mobile computing?
Mobility and broad reach.
Name three applications of M-Commerce.
Financial services, location-based services, and telemetry applications.
What is a mobile wallet?
A digital tool for contactless payments using NFC technology.
What is IoT (Internet of Things)?
A network of interconnected devices with processing power and connectivity.
Name two examples of IoT applications in healthcare.
Wearable sensors and implantable devices for monitoring health.
What is the role of RFID in IoT?
Enables identification and tracking of objects in IoT systems.
What are two value-added attributes of mobile computing?
Personalization and localization of products/services.
